Output ab8c228fa3d4834c5e65d2743f54f45e1567b8ac626d0f3ed2e5c2a63315946f:1

value
2909742
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fdb21fd897ab24987768cb750f235d08619e97c OP_EQUALVERIFY OP_CHECKSIG
address
16pe5hTC3MtC9pYMKaLuK4WmcyPxwW23ao
transaction
ab8c228fa3d4834c5e65d2743f54f45e1567b8ac626d0f3ed2e5c2a63315946f
confirmations
342189
spent
true